Transaction 68642e2095f59d9a7a60aec5f086a7c7c81f55db5c7e7f3a93ad6f344aea47d4
1 Input
2 Outputs
- 68642e2095f59d9a7a60aec5f086a7c7c81f55db5c7e7f3a93ad6f344aea47d4:0
- 68642e2095f59d9a7a60aec5f086a7c7c81f55db5c7e7f3a93ad6f344aea47d4:1
value 125707
address 1FMDgTfviUfsg8Tw3ChKbgiSwnhJX8xJuK
value 2367403
address 17WaLg51XD2Vp4HNbdanPc3VfDS2Y2WRw3